Using Drugs

When do the good times become a problem? Maybe it’s time for someone to think about cutting back or stopping their drug use if they’re:
  • using more than they planned to and for longer
  • feeling guilty about drug use
  • needing to take more to get the same effect
  • spending a lot of time thinking about/wanting drugs, or recovering from them
  • unable to enjoy clubbing or sex unless on something.
Someone stands a better chance of controlling their drug and/or alcohol use if they first:
  • think about what they do and why, and the up-sides and down-sides
  • plan changes they want to make, but don’t aim to change too much at once.
  • act and use support from others if needed, because changing can be hard
  • try to avoid what (or who) triggers your drug/alcohol use. Replace them with other things you enjoy.
